  • Opening of a Local Bank Account 

Did you know that opening a local bank account saves you from heavy charges of international bank transfers? It must be your first and foremost step when you are about to start studying on a foreign university’s campus. It assists you a lot in financial survival like never before. So you can take the help of an IDP counsellor who’ll furnish you with the information of leading banks in your country. However, the services may vary from bank to bank but make sure that you are getting the maximum benefits on account of a student. 

  • Prepare Budget Roadmap

A company always does budget planning and allocation before starting any project and all. Likewise, when you are shifting abroad for studies, make sure that you craft a concise budget roadmap that eventually helps you manage your finances. For planning this, you must know your present financial situation. While creating budget planning, consider all the factors, such as study material, transportation, grocery, monthly accommodation rent, WIFI charges, and last but certainly, not least is travelling expenses. Additionally, try to save at least some amount every month for emergencies.

  • Additional Income with Part-Time 

Most countries enable students to do part-time work to support their lifestyle. Therefore, one can work up to 20 hours per week. Isn’t that great? However, when you are having term breaks, you can get your hands-on work full-time and earn well. But, make sure that your student visa is applicable for this job and then search for the job accordingly.

In this manner, you can earn additional income and grab some additional workforce skills as well. Most noteworthy, you may also need to pay some tax on the earnings as per the country’s rules and regulations. Your part-time job helps you pay all your monthly bills, including credit card payments.

  • Smart Planning

Studying abroad with smart strategic planning can be a cakewalk. You can put down the priority list highlighting what you want. After putting it down, analyze how it can be done cost-effectively. Have intensive thinking on how you can manage those priorities at less cost and save some money. Here are some ways that you alleviate your daily expenses-

  1. Prefer to share PG accommodation
  2. Prefer shopping during bumper discounts or sales
  3. Get your hands on students’ discount cards.
  4. Buy local transport pass
  5. Try to buy groceries from the community store
  • College Expenses 

Don’t forget to have some intensive research beforehand if you are eligible for any scholarships or not. Did you know that there are some universities in countries that provide allowances and huge scholarships to students? It can be in the form of cash or allowances. Therefore, make sure that you do best in your school time so that you can get considered for such types of allowances. Apart from this, there will be some book expenses, but these can be managed if you buy second-hand books. A better option than this is getting a library membership. Most importantly, make sure to have enough research before taking admission into any university.
